Key Features and Endpoints
The Metals-API offers a variety of endpoints that cater to different needs, allowing developers to retrieve essential data efficiently. Here are some of the key features:
- Latest Rates Endpoint: This endpoint provides real-time exchange rate data for metals, updated every 60 minutes or more frequently depending on the subscription plan. For example, developers can retrieve the latest EGP rates against other currencies, enabling them to make informed decisions.
- Historical Rates Endpoint: Historical rates are available for most currencies dating back to 2019. By appending a specific date to the API request, developers can access past exchange rates, which is crucial for market analysis and forecasting.
- Bid and Ask Endpoint: This feature allows users to retrieve real-time bid and ask prices for metals, providing insights into market liquidity and pricing strategies.
- Convert Endpoint: The Metals-API includes a currency conversion endpoint that enables users to convert any amount from one currency to another, including EGP to USD or other metals.
- Time-Series Endpoint: Developers can query the API for daily historical rates between two dates of their choice, which is essential for analyzing trends over time.
- Fluctuation Endpoint: This endpoint provides information about how currencies fluctuate on a day-to-day basis, allowing developers to track volatility in the EGP market.
- Carat Endpoint: Users can retrieve information about gold rates by carat, which is particularly useful for jewelers and investors in precious metals.
- Lowest/Highest Price Endpoint: This feature allows users to query the API to get the lowest and highest prices for a specific date, aiding in market analysis.
- Open/High/Low/Close (OHLC) Price Endpoint: Developers can access OHLC data for a specific time period, which is vital for technical analysis.
- Historical LME Endpoint: This endpoint provides access to historical rates for LME symbols dating back to 2008, which is beneficial for long-term market analysis.
- API Key: Each user is assigned a unique API key that must be included in the API requests to authenticate access.
- API Response: The API delivers exchange rates relative to USD by default, ensuring consistency in data representation.
- Available Endpoints: The Metals-API features 14 different endpoints, each providing unique functionalities tailored to various user needs.
- Supported Symbols Endpoint: This endpoint returns a constantly updated list of all available currencies, including the EGP, making it easy for developers to stay informed.
- News Endpoint: Users can retrieve the latest news articles related to various metals, keeping them updated on market trends.

API Endpoint Examples and Responses
Latest Rates Endpoint
Get real-time exchange rates for all available metals:
{
"success": true,
"timestamp": 1778285293,
"base": "USD",
"date": "2026-05-09",
"rates": {
"XAU": 0.000482,
"XAG": 0.03815,
"XPT": 0.000912,
"XPD": 0.000744,
"XCU": 0.294118,
"XAL": 0.434783,
"XNI": 0.142857,
"XZN": 0.344828
},
"unit": "per troy ounce"
}
